Had Cystic Ovaries, Yeast Infection. Bleeding For Months Post Hysterectomy. What Is The Cause?
I am having Bleeding 8 months after my Full Hysterectomy. I know I will need to go to my Dr. But it is Sunday so I do not want to worry all night. It hurts to urinate and I started out bleeding just a pink discharge while it hurt. Now I am up to about a table spoon of blood 4 hours later. Should I be concerned and go to the urgent care tonight? Or will I be okay until in the morning and see my own Dr.? Also what could cause this? I have not had intercourse in 2 years so that is not it. Nor anything else. I did have a Cyst on both ovaries removed one was 7.5 pounds and the other was 10 pounds. They were quite huge. I have also been having yeast infections which are severe enough I have had to go to my Dr. and get prescription meds to help. Thank you
I am sorry to hear about your vaginal bleeding after hysterectomy. Vaginal bleeding in a lady like you can only originate from the vaginal. You will need a good clinical exam to establish the cause. This could be caused by an infection, growth, bleeding abnormalities etc. Even if the cysts were to recur in your ovaries, it will not present with pervaginal bleeding. Also, because it hurts to urinate, you could have an associated urinary tract infection but this doesn't cause vaginal bleeding all by itself.
